Bieke Buckinx
Painter
Bieke (@biekebuckinx) became a full-time painter in 2020, and one of the first things we worked on was something surprisingly practical: writing and rehearsing an elevator pitch. Being able to explain, on the spot, who she is and what she does mattered enormously to her — that's often where real confidence starts.
She'd already done a lot of groundwork before we began, including organizing her own exhibition. What she needed wasn't a plan built from scratch, but a second, objective pair of eyes — someone to help her make the decisions she'd otherwise sit on.
When things didn't go as planned, I helped her find the more constructive way to look at it. And when something stayed unresolved for too long, I wasn't afraid to give her a nudge — or, let's be honest, the occasional kick — to prioritize based on what actually mattered to her.
Bieke wanted a professional sounding board: objective, but genuinely invested. That's exactly the role I stepped into — reviewing her choices, giving honest feedback, and helping her keep moving toward the next level of her artist career.
"Katrijn and I clicked from minute 1. You feel that she has a positive but realistic outlook on life, and that is exactly what I needed... She was a perfect & objective sounding board a.k.a. blissful coach!" — Bieke Buckinx
Since our trajectory ended, I've stayed close — I've seen her grow with every exhibition, and she still drops in every now and then for a single session whenever she needs one. I've been honored to support her through both the good times and the harder ones, and Bieke has grown into one of the most recognized painters in her scene.
